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F and line baking sheets with parchment paper. Place the butter, peanut butter, brown sugar, and cream cheese in a large mixing bowl and beat on medium-low speed until smooth (about 1 minute). Add the egg yolk and mix on medium speed until combined.
Scrape the bottom and sides of the bowl with a silicone spatula, then add the flour, cornstarch, and salt. Mix on medium-low speed until a stiff dough forms (about 1 minute). If the dough is too sticky to handle, try stirring in a little more flour.
Roll a managable amount of dough at a time to 3/16-inch thick (rolling pin rings ensure an even and exact thickness) between 2 sheets of parchment paper. Remove the top sheet of parchment, and cut shapes with a 3-inch heart cookie cutter. Peel the shapes from the bottom layer of parchment and place them on the prepared baking sheets.
Bake for 10 to 14 minutes, or until just barely beginning to turn golden on the bottoms.
Cool completely, then decorate with royal icing, buttercream, or whipped ganache, if desired.
